Knobbe Martens Partner Eric Furman Presents “Protecting Innovation in Regenerative Cell Medicine” at Korean-American Scientists and Engineers Association Conference

| Eric Furman, Ph.D.

Knobbe Martens Olson & Bear LLP partner Eric Furman Ph.D., J.D. will present “Protecting Innovation in Regenerative Cell Medicine” at the 23rd Annual Korean-American Scientists and Engineers Association South Western Regional Conference on Saturday, February 16. The conference will be held at the Carlsbad Sheraton Resort & Spa, 5480 Grand Pacific Drive, Carlsbad, California.

The presentation will explore different claiming strategies that are useful in the United States to gain patent protection for regenerative cell populations. He will discuss the strengths and weaknesses of product claims as well as methods of making and using these products. Approaches to prevent accidental anticipation and inherency will also be provided.

Dr. Furman, a partner in Knobbe Martens’ San Diego office, focuses on patent protection and other forms of intellectual property protection for biotechnology, pharmaceuticals and medical devices. His practice includes strategic patent counseling and procurement, freedom to operate analysis, counseling on infringement and invalidity issues, licensing and due diligence studies as related to negotiations for mergers and acquisitions.

The Korean-American Scientists and Engineers Association, established in 1971, helps Korean-American Scientists and Engineers develop their full career potential by promoting the application of science and technology for the general welfare of society and fostering international cooperation, especially between the U.S. and Korea. The organization has over 3,000 registered members with 67 local chapters and 14 technical groups across the United States.
